An organism which contains one or more incomplete chromosome sets is known as aneuploid. Aneuploidy can be either due to loss of one or more chromosomes i.e. hypo-ploidy or due to addition of one or more chromosomes to complete chromosome complement i.e. hyper-ploidy.
